Click the Select Data Check drop-down arrow on the Data Reviewer toolbar, click the plus sign (+) next to Z Value Checks, then click Evaluate Z Values Check .To find the cumulative probability of a z-score equal to -1.21, cross-reference the row containing -1.2 of the table with the column holding 0.01. The table explains that the probability that a standard normal random variable will be less than -1.21 is 0.1131; that is, P (Z < -1.21) = 0.1131. This table is also called a z-score table. A z -score is a measure of position that indicates the number of standard deviations a data value lies from the mean. It is the horizontal scale of a standard normal distribution. The z -score is positive if the value lies above the mean, and negative if it lies below the mean. If you have compted a Z-score you can find the probability of a Z-score less than that by using pnorm(Z). ... The probability that a 60 year old ...For 95% the Z value is 1.960. Step 3: use that Z value in this formula for the Confidence Interval. X ± Z s√n. Where: X is the mean; Z is the chosen Z-value from the table above; s is the standard deviation; n is the number of observations; And we have: 175 ± 1.960 × 20√40. Which is: 175cm ± 6.20cm. In other words: from 168.8cm to 181.2cm Z-score = (x - μ) / σ. Where: x is the value of your data point. μ is the mean of the sample or data set. σ is the standard deviation. For a recent final exam in STAT 500, the mean was 68.55 with a standard deviation of 15.45. If you scored an 80%: Z = ( 80 − 68.55) 15.45 = 0.74, which means your score of 80 was 0.74 SD above the mean ... A 1 in a z-score means 1 standard deviation, not 1 unit. So if the standard deviation of the data set is 1.69, a z-score of 1 would mean that the data point is 1.69 units above the mean. In Sal's example, the z-score of the data point is -0.59, meaning the point is approximately 0.59 standard deviations, or 1 unit, below the mean, which we can ... In this case, it is 1.0.Solution: The z score for the given data is, z= (85-70)/12=1.25. From the z score table, the fraction of the data within this score is 0.8944. This means 89.44 % of the students are within the test scores of 85 and hence the percentage of students who are above the test scores of 85 = (100-89.44)% = 10.56 %.

This table is also called a z-score table.Critical value (z*) for a given confidence level. If we want to be 95% confident, we need to build a confidence interval that extends about 2 standard errors above and below our estimate. More precisely, it's actually 1.96 standard errors. This is called a critical value (z*). We can calculate a critical value z* for any given confidence level ... A 1-sample Z-test calculates a Z-value of −1.03. You choose an α of 0.05, which results in a critical value of 1.96. Because the absolute value of the Z-value is less than 1.96, you fail to reject the null hypothesis and cannot conclude that the mold's mean depth is …This Z-test calculator is a tool that helps you perform a one-sample Z-test on the population's mean.
